MARINE PARADE

Few main roads in Brighton have changed less over the years than Marine parade. Individual houses have been demolished or rebuilt but generally Marine Parade presents the same appearance as it did a century ago. Even the width of the road is the same. These three photographs of 1925 show the area around Royal Crescent, and are worth studying in conjunction with the large photograph of 1875, on a previous page.
